It depends on where you took the degree (country), and the specific school. The master's in science can be abbreviated in a number of ways. For example M.S., M.Sc., etc.

How Powerful is a Criminal Justice BS Degree?

A criminal justice BS degree is a must have for any career oriented person who wishes to advance in the criminal justice field. Most universities and online colleges offer a BS degree program in criminal justice, giving people many options to further their careers. A bachelor of science in criminal justice degree program usually takes 124 to 128 credits to complete. People who achieve a BS in criminal justice can use the degree to further their education or immediately enter the criminal justice field.
